    About Noëllyne

    Noëllyne shimmers with a delicate, festive charm, a name that evokes the quiet magic of Christmas without being overtly themed. Its Latin roots, signifying "born on Christmas," are beautifully softened by the elegant French-inspired suffix, offering a graceful alternative to more common Noël variations. This is a name for parents who appreciate a soft, melodic sound and a touch of refined whimsy, perhaps for a winter baby or simply to carry a feeling of gentle celebration through the year. Noëllyne feels both contemporary and timeless, a rare gem that stands out with its unique spelling while remaining easily recognizable.
